    You can disable hibernation if it is enabled and you do not...

    When you Hibernate your computer, Windows saves the contents of the system memory in the hiberfil.sys file. As a result, the size of the hiberfil.sys file will always be equal to the amount of physical memory in your system. If you don't use the Hibernate feature and want to reclaim the space used by Windows for the hiberfil.sys file, perform the following steps:

    -Start the Control Panel Power Options applet (go to start, settings, Control Panel, and then click Power Options).
    -Select the Hibernate tab, uncheck "Activate the hibernation", and then click OK. Although you might think otherwise, selecting never under "Hibernate" option on the power management tab does not delete the hiberfil.sys file.
    -Windows remove the "Hibernate" option on the power management tab and delete the hiberfil.sys file.

    Hello

    Unless this procedure is located in the HR schema, it needs SELECT on HR.employees table privileges.

    Say the procedure is located in the FUBAR scheme (in other words, connect you to Oracle as FUBAR to create).

    To grant privileges on the table HR.employees to FUBAR. Then connect like HR and say:

    GRANT SELECT ON employees to fubar;

    or, if you want everyone on your system to be able to query this table

    Employees of SELECT GRANT IT to THE PUBLIC.

    If you're not allowed to do this, ask your DBA to do.  All the tables in the HR schema provided by Oracle were put there by Oracle to demonstrate things in the documentation.  There is nothing secret or dangerous about reading anything in this scheme.  On my system PUBLIC has privileges SELECT on all tables in the HR schema.

    If the employee (plural) table is not in the same schema as the procedure (e.g., FUBAR), so you must INSERT privileges on the table, too.

    Oracle doesn't have a way to grant privileges on all the tables in a schema; You must grant privileges on each table, one at a time.
